Understanding Zee Entertainment's Stock Performance

Tracking Zee Entertainment's stock requires a comprehensive understanding of various market dynamics and company-specific news. Several factors can influence the fluctuations in its share price, ranging from overall market sentiment to specific announcements related to the company. First and foremost, the general trends in the Indian stock market play a significant role. For instance, a bullish market (where prices are generally rising) can positively impact Zee Entertainment's stock, while a bearish market (where prices are generally falling) can have the opposite effect. These broad market movements are often driven by macroeconomic factors such as GDP growth, inflation rates, and interest rate policies set by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I). These economic indicators provide a backdrop against which all listed companies, including Zee Entertainment, operate.

Furthermore, news and developments specific to Zee Entertainment are critical in shaping its stock price. Key announcements related to earnings reports, strategic partnerships, mergers and acquisitions, and regulatory changes can trigger significant movements in the stock. For example, a strong earnings report that exceeds analysts' expectations typically leads to an increase in investor confidence, driving up the share price. Conversely, disappointing financial results can lead to a sell-off, causing the stock price to decline. Strategic partnerships, such as collaborations with other media companies or technology firms, can also signal growth and innovation, positively impacting the stock. Mergers and acquisitions, especially those involving significant value or market share implications, often result in substantial stock price volatility as investors assess the potential benefits and risks of the deal. Regulatory changes, such as new broadcasting guidelines or restrictions on content, can also affect investor sentiment and, consequently, the stock price. Therefore, keeping abreast of these company-specific developments is essential for understanding the dynamics of Zee Entertainment's stock.

Moreover, investor sentiment and market speculation can significantly influence the stock price, sometimes independently of fundamental factors. Investor sentiment refers to the overall mood or attitude of investors towards a particular stock or the market in general. Positive sentiment, often fueled by rumors, analyst recommendations, or general optimism, can drive up demand for the stock, leading to a price increase. Negative sentiment, on the other hand, can result in a sell-off, pushing the price down. Market speculation, which involves buying or selling stock based on anticipated future price movements, can also create volatility. For instance, rumors about a potential takeover or a significant deal can lead to speculative buying, driving up the price even before any official announcement is made. It's important to recognize that while sentiment and speculation can create short-term price movements, they are often not sustainable in the long run if not supported by underlying fundamentals. Therefore, investors should exercise caution and rely on a combination of fundamental analysis and market awareness to make informed decisions about Zee Entertainment's stock.

Analyzing NSE Data for Zee Entertainment

To really get a grip on Zee Entertainment's stock, diving into the NSE (National Stock Exchange) data is super important. The NSE provides a wealth of information that can help you understand the stock's performance and make informed decisions. Key data points to watch include the opening price, closing price, intraday high and low, trading volume, and delivery volume. The opening price tells you where the stock started trading for the day, while the closing price indicates its final value at the end of the trading session. The intraday high and low provide a range of price fluctuations throughout the day, giving you a sense of the stock's volatility. Trading volume refers to the number of shares that have been traded during the day, which can indicate the level of investor interest in the stock. Delivery volume represents the number of shares that are actually transferred from one account to another, as opposed to intraday trades that are squared off before the end of the day. A high delivery volume suggests that investors are holding onto the stock for the long term, which can be a sign of confidence.

Beyond these basic data points, the NSE also provides information on the stock's 52-week high and low, which can help you understand its historical performance. The 52-week high represents the highest price the stock has reached in the past year, while the 52-week low indicates the lowest price. Comparing the current price to these levels can give you a sense of whether the stock is trading near its peak or its trough. The NSE also provides data on the stock's price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io, which is a valuation metric that compares the stock's price to its earnings per share. A high P/E ratio may suggest that the stock is overvalued, while a low P/E ratio may indicate that it is undervalued. However, it's important to compare the P/E ratio to those of other companies in the same industry to get a more accurate assessment.

Furthermore, the NSE website offers charts and graphs that visually represent the stock's price movements over different time periods. These charts can help you identify trends, patterns, and potential support and resistance levels. Support levels are price levels at which the stock tends to find buying support, preventing it from falling further. Resistance levels are price levels at which the stock tends to encounter selling pressure, preventing it from rising higher. By analyzing these charts, you can gain insights into the stock's potential future direction. It's also helpful to look at the stock's performance relative to the overall market indices, such as the Nifty 50 or the Sensex. This can tell you whether the stock is outperforming or underperforming the market, which can be an important factor to consider when making investment decisions.
